阿里云(ECS)实例中所指的 CPU核数,默认情况下是指 逻辑核(vCPU),而不是物理核。
🔍 详细解释:
✅ 什么是逻辑核(vCPU)?
- 逻辑核(也叫虚拟CPU,vCPU)是操作系统看到的CPU核心数量。
- 它可能是物理核心(物理CPU的独立处理单元),也可能是通过超线程技术(Hyper-Threading)虚拟出来的核心。
- 在阿里云ECS实例中,一个vCPU通常对应一个线程(Thread)。
🧠 举例说明:
-
如果一台服务器的CPU是Intel处理器,支持超线程,有 2个物理CPU,每个CPU有 4核,那么总共:
- 物理核心:8个
- 逻辑核心(vCPU):16个(如果开启超线程,每个物理核提供2个线程)
-
那么你在阿里云上购买一个 8核CPU的ECS实例,你实际获得的是 8个逻辑核心(vCPU)。
📌 阿里云文档说明(官方依据):
阿里云官方文档中明确指出:
vCPU(虚拟CPU)是云服务器ECS实例中虚拟出来的CPU资源,一个vCPU代表一个逻辑处理器(线程)。
- 来源:阿里云ECS产品文档 – 实例规格
🧩 如何查看ECS实例的vCPU数量?
你可以通过以下方式查看:
-
在ECS控制台:
- 进入实例详情页 → 查看“CPU”信息。
-
在Linux系统中执行命令:
lscpu或
nproc -
Windows系统中:
- 打开任务管理器 → 性能 → CPU,查看逻辑处理器数量。
📝 小结:
| 类型 | 是否阿里云默认表示 | 说明 |
|---|---|---|
| 逻辑核(vCPU) | ✅ 是 | 通常对应一个线程,是ECS实例中表示CPU数量的标准 |
| 物理核 | ❌ 否 | 阿里云通常不直接提供物理核心数量 |
如果你有特定的性能需求(如避免超线程影响),可以考虑使用 裸金属服务器 或 专属主机(DDH),这些产品可以提供更细粒度的控制。
如需进一步了解某类实例的CPU架构,也可以提供实例类型(如 ecs.c6.large),我可以帮你查具体配置。
CLOUD技术博